Andrew Song had a dream of owning a restaurant of his own, and after many years of experience working in the restaurant industry, his dream of ownership came true last year with Umaichi Ramen. He and his staff are proud to celebrate their one-year anniversary in business. “We may be a new restaurant in town, but it brings me joy to see people enjoying their very first bowl of ramen, and already so many have come back,” says Andrew.
“As a business owner, there is no better feeling in the world.” Andrew enjoys sharing and introducing his extensive knowledge and cooking skills with those who have followed him throughout the years.
Ramen is a classic Japanese dish that, if done right, can make for an everyday tasty meal. At Umaichi Ramen, they take pride in perfecting their ramen. Eight expertly crafted ramen dishes are available to choose from. The TanTan Spicy Miso Ramen and the Umaichi Tonkotsu Ramen are just a few of the favorites of loyal customers. Starting in May, they will introduce Tonkatsu Curry Rice, Cold Green Tea Zaru Soba, Spicy Tuna Bao Bun, Seared Tuna Carppacio with Yuzu dressing and Yuzu Iichiko Sake. And for their one-year anniversary special, enjoy Bacon Honey Toast with Maple Syrup!
Umaichi Ramen has stapled their restaurant as the place to go for excellent ramen dishes, yet their variety of unique appetizers and modern twists on classic Japanese entrees has made it more than just a ramen shop. A favorite appetizer of mine has to be the Mochi Cheese Gratin located on their “Something to Share” menu option. Freshly prepared classic mochi is layered with melted Brie cheese, seaweed strips, green onions, and spices to create a rich, mouth-watering dish unlike anything I’ve seen before.
The ambiance set in Umaichi is welcoming and friendly. Anyone can walk in, take a seat, and await a dining experience of Japanese ‘soul food’ made from the very best.
